CHAPTER 14
PRIMER DISENGAGING UNIT
Maintenance Attention
To remove the disengaging unit, slacken the hose clips and remove the rubber priming
hose. Disengage the primer return spring, and swing the primer upwards and clear of
the disengaging unit.
Disconnect the pipe union on the underside of the disengaging unit and unscrew the
disengaging unit from the bracket.
The primer release pipe may now be removed from the pump body if necessary.
The disengaging unit is dismantled by removing the circlip, washer and rubber cap from
the spindle, then unscrewing the six nuts and washers from the studs in the housing.
The diaphragm should now be examined for deterioration cracks, etc. To dismantle the
diaphragm assembly, unscrew the self-locking nut from the end of the spindle.
When re-assembling the diaphragm assembly, ensure that the diaphragm pressure
plate is fitted and use a new self-locking nut.
